Tectonic uplift history and its environmental effects of active orogenic belts under the background of extruded structures have always been a hotspot in geoscience research.The terrestrial sedimentary sequence in the foreland basin contains abundant information about tectonic uplift history and climate changes in the adjacent orogenic belt.In general,this set of sedimentary sequences in the foreland basin shows a tendency to thicken upward on the profile.Coarse-grained sediments generally appear in the upper part of the sedimentary sequence.The formation mechanism of this coarsening upward sediment exists debate on the structural cause theory or climate driving theory among relevant scholars,and there is no final conclusion.As an intercontinental extruded orogenic belt,the Tianshan Mountains have received Cenozoic deposits up to 5000 m in foreland,which has the characteristic of coarsening upward.The upper part of this profile is present as alluvial fan facies,composed of gray or black-gray grindstone,which is named as Xiyu conglomerate by Huang in the salt water ditch near the Kuqa River in the southern Chinese Tian Shan Mountains.The research on the Cenozoic deposits in northern Chinese Tian Shan foreland is focused on magnetostratigraphy study and sedimentology.On the Basis of previous studies,our work is focus on heavy mineral analysis and detrital zircon U-Pb chronology of the Cenozoic deposits in the Urumqi River section and Taxi River section,whose stratigraphic chronological framework was established by our project team before.Main achievements of this study are summarized as following:(1)The results of heavy minerals analysis show that the sedimentary components of Urumqi River section are mainly composed of mafic igneous rocks,supplemented by metamorphic rocks,and the depositional environment is oxidizing milieu.There are three types of heavy minerals combinations in the formation,Samples WZ1-WZ7(~5.8-4.2Ma): The dominant minerals are ilmenite-hematite-epidote-sashimi,and the characteristic minerals are barite;Samples WZ8-WZ10(~2.7-1.0Ma): the dominant minerals are ilmenite-hematite-chlorite-magnetite,and the characteristic mineral are hornblende;Sample WZ11-WZ12(~0.6-0.5Ma): the dominant minerals are hematiteilmenite-Epidote-magnetic hematite-white titanium stone,the characteristic minerals are hornblende-zircon-apatite-anatase.The heavy mineral characteristic index indicates that the granite or hornblende is rich in the source area.The sedimentary components in the Taxi River section are mainly composed of mafic volcanic rocks,supplemented by metamorphic rocks,with less intermediateacidic igneous rock(such as zircon,tourmaline,rutile,and apatite and so on),and the depositional environment is oxidized Environment,there are three types of heavy mineral combinations in the stratum,Sample TXZ0-TXZ1(~1.74-1.57Ma): The dominant minerals are hematite-epidote-magnetite-chrome-spinel,and the characteristic minerals are garnet-epidote-chromium spinel;Sample TXZ2-TXZ4(~3.37-2.34Ma): The dominant minerals are hematite-epidote-chromite-maghemite,and the characteristic minerals are garnet-white titanite-chromium spinel;Sample TXZ5-TXZ8(~6.64-3.83Ma): The dominant minerals are hematite-ilmenite-epidotemagnetite.The heavy mineral characteristic index shows that schist,hornblende or granulite is rich in the source area.(2)Based on the zircons U-Pb age spectrum and multi-dimensional scale graph,the zircon U-Pb isotopic ages range in the Urumqi River section are ~250-300 Ma,~300-340 Ma,~340-400 Ma and ~400-500 Ma.The main age range of sample WZ1 is dominated by ~250-300 Ma.The age distribution of samples WZ4,WZ8,WZ9 are similar,whose main zircon age range are ~250-300 Ma or ~300-340 Ma.Upward in profile,the proportion of ~250-300 Ma is increasing and the proportion of 300-340 Ma is decreasing.The age distribution of Sample WZ11 is Multimodal,including age range of ~400-500 Ma,~250-300 Ma,~300-340 Ma,~340-400 Ma,are almost equal.The distribution of WZ1 and WZ11 is also scattered in the multi-dimensional scale graph.Based on the zircon U-Pb age spectrum and multi-dimensional scale graph,the zircon U-Pb isotopic ages in the Taxi River section are mainly consist of ~170-200 Ma,~295-315 Ma,~315-335 Ma,~415-425 Ma and ~460Ma.The age spectrums are typical of double-peak,the main peak is ~295-315 Ma or ~315-335 Ma with little change,while the secondary peak changes significantly.The secondary peak of sample TXZ2,TXZ3,TXZ6,TXZ8 are ~415-425 Ma,while TXZ0's changes to ~460Ma.The multidimensional scale graph shows that TXZ0 is far away from others.Based on the Kolmogorov-Smirnov non-parametric test,this paper verifies the significance of differences between the late Cenozoic stratigraphic samples in the Urumqi River section and Taxi River section,According to the established magnetic stratigraphic chronological framework,the source of late Cenozoic sediments of Urumqi River section changes in ~5.8-4.6Ma and ~2.6Ma-0.5Ma,and the source of late Cenozoic sediments of Taxi River section changes in ~1.57-1.93 Ma.Both profiles have changes in sediment sources since ~2.0 Ma.(4)Based on the history of the quaternary glaciers in the Tianshan Mountains,this source adjustment may be caused by the strong erosion of the glaciers in the early Quaternary period of the Tianshan Mountains.Further analysis of five bedrock zircon samples according to DZMix and DZMds simulation in the Urumqi River Basin reveals that the sediment sources in Urumqi River section are mainly from the veins of the Tianshan Mountains during ~5.8 to ~2.6 Ma,after ~2.6 Ma,the sedimentary input of Houxia fault depression increased significantly.Combined with the natural geographical conditions and uplifting history of Urumqi River Basin,Houxia fault depression zone become an important source for piedmont deposit since the Quaternary period.
